How to calculate 46 is what percent of 50?

To find out what percent 46 is of 50, you can use the formula: (46 / 50) x 100. This will give you the percentage of 46 in relation to 50. In this case, the answer would be 92%, meaning that 46 is 92% of 50.

How can percentages be converted to fractions?

To convert a percentage to a fraction, you simply write the percentage as a fraction with a denominator of 100. For example, 25% would be written as 25/100, which can be further simplified to 1/4.

Is it possible for a percentage to exceed 100%?

Percentages are commonly understood to range from 0% to 100%, representing the entire value or 100% of it. However, in some cases, percentages can exceed 100% when dealing with situations such as growth rates, markups, or multipliers. Exceeding 100% signifies an increase or expansion beyond the original value.
